The main news item on Three Counties Radio this afternoon is that the Government is to provide £19m for the rebuilding of junction 10A of the M1, which will remove the roundabout at Kidney Wood and add an extra lane making a total of 3 in each direction up to Capability Green. This will allow the free flow of traffic at peak times up to the airport.

It is presenting itself as the closest airport to the Games after London City in Docklands. The two and a half million passengers passing through Luton next July and August will be able to use Javelin trains to the Olympic Park if they travel on to St Pancras.
Used the service on Saturday. Total travel time to Stratford International from Luton was under an hour. It was also under an hour coming back as the Olympic Stadium is only 6 minutes from St Pancras using the high speed rail link.

The removal of the Kidney Wood roundabout will be fantastic, will it be done ASAP before next summers Olympics?
Not a hope in hell. The consultation report is not published until December then a planning application has to be submitted. Doubt it will started in 2012 and then will probably take 18 months to complete as there is a complex road layout to be built and a new road bridge under the M1 spur road to be constructed.
